Overview

Location: Ideally based in the North West, Midlands, or North East of the UK

Salary: £49,000 basic per annum | OTE £70,000-£75,000 (including overtime, weekends, overnight stays, and travel allowances)

We are working in partnership with a leading UK manufacturer of industrial steam boilers and equipment to recruit an experienced Commissioning Engineer / Commercial Gas Engineer. This is a fantastic opportunity for an engineer with strong technical skills, a flexible approach to travel, and a background in commissioning large industrial systems.

Responsibilities

  • Lead commissioning projects for high-capacity steam boiler systems across industrial sites throughout the UK.
  • Collaborate with project managers and contractors to ensure installations are completed smoothly and operate safely and efficiently.
  • Carry out system testing, fault-finding, and calibration, using diagnostic software and control systems to fine-tune performance.
  • Provide ongoing technical support after commissioning and maintain strong client relationships, offering solutions to operational issues.
  • Travel frequently and stay away from home when necessary; weekend and night work may be required.
  • Travel and accommodation expenses, a company vehicle, meal allowances, and access to benefits are provided.

Qualifications

  • Relevant qualifications such as an HNC/HND in Mechanical or Electrical Engineering, commercial gas ACS, COCN1.
  • Hands-on experience commissioning industrial boilers or similar plant equipment.
  • Strong problem-solving abilities, solid IT skills, and excellent communication with clients and colleagues.

Benefits

  • Competitive package with travel and accommodation expenses covered, company vehicle, meal allowances, pension scheme, and potential private healthcare.
